Gane is a term that can refer to several different things, depending on the context. In linguistic usage, gane appears as a dialect form in Scots English and related varieties, where it functions as a past participle or past tense form of the verb "go." In such usage, it conveys meaning akin to "gone" or "going," as in phrases describing movement or completion of an action.
